+# django-types [![PyPI](https://img.shields.io/pypi/v/django-types.svg)](https://pypi.org/project/django-types/)
+
+Type stubs for [Django](https://www.djangoproject.com).
+
+> Note: this project was forked from
+> <https://github.com/typeddjango/django-stubs> with the goal of removing the
+> [`mypy`](https://github.com/python/mypy) plugin dependency so that `mypy`
+> can't [crash due to Django
+> config](https://github.com/typeddjango/django-stubs/issues/318), and that
+> non-`mypy` type checkers like
+> [`pyright`](https://github.com/microsoft/pyright) will work better with
+> Django.
+
+## install
+
+```bash
+pip install django-types
+```
+
+You'll need to monkey patch Django's `QuerySet`, `Manager` (not needed for Django 3.1+) and
+`ForeignKey` (not needed for Django 4.1+) classes so we can index into them with a generic
+argument. Add this to your settings.py:
+
+```python
+# in settings.py
+from django.db.models import ForeignKey
+from django.db.models.manager import BaseManager
+from django.db.models.query import QuerySet
+
+# NOTE: there are probably other items you'll need to monkey patch depending on
+# your version.
+for cls in [QuerySet, BaseManager, ForeignKey]:
+ cls.__class_getitem__ = classmethod(lambda cls, *args, **kwargs: cls) # type: ignore [attr-defined]
+```
+
+## usage
+
+### ForeignKey ids and related names as properties in ORM models
+
+When defining a Django ORM model with a foreign key, like so:
+
+```python
+class User(models.Model):
+ team = models.ForeignKey(
+ "Team",
+ null=True,
+ on_delete=models.SET_NULL,
+ )
+ role = models.ForeignKey(
+ "Role",
+ null=True,
+ on_delete=models.SET_NULL,
+ related_name="users",
+ )
+```
+
+two properties are created, `team` as expected, and `team_id`. Also, a related
+manager called `user_set` is created on `Team` for the reverse access.
+
+In order to properly add typing to the foreign key itself and also for the created ids you can do
+something like this:
+
+```python
+from typing import TYPE_CHECKING
+
+from someapp.models import Team
+if TYPE_CHECKING:
+ # In this example Role cannot be imported due to circular import issues,
+ # but doing so inside TYPE_CHECKING will make sure that the typing below
+ # knows what "Role" means
+ from anotherapp.models import Role
+
+
+class User(models.Model):
+ team_id: Optional[int]
+ team = models.ForeignKey(
+ Team,
+ null=True,
+ on_delete=models.SET_NULL,
+ )
+ role_id: int
+ role = models.ForeignKey["Role"](
+ "Role",
+ null=False,
+ on_delete=models.SET_NULL,
+ related_name="users",
+ )
+
+
+reveal_type(User().team)
+# note: Revealed type is 'Optional[Team]'
+reveal_type(User().role)
+# note: Revealed type is 'Role'
+```
+
+This will make sure that `team_id` and `role_id` can be accessed. Also, `team` and `role`
+will be typed to their right objects.
+
+To be able to access the related manager `Team` and `Role` you could do:
+
+```python
+from typing import TYPE_CHECKING
+
+if TYPE_CHECKING:
+ # This doesn't really exists on django so it always need to be imported this way
+ from django.db.models.manager import RelatedManager
+ from user.models import User
+
+
+class Team(models.Model):
+ if TYPE_CHECKING:
+ user_set = RelatedManager["User"]()
+
+
+class Role(models.Model):
+ if TYPE_CHECKING:
+ users = RelatedManager["User"]()
+
+reveal_type(Team().user_set)
+# note: Revealed type is 'RelatedManager[User]'
+reveal_type(Role().users)
+# note: Revealed type is 'RelatedManager[User]'
+```
+
+An alternative is using annotations:
+
+
+
+```python
+from __future__ import annotations # or just be in python 3.11
+
+from typing import TYPE_CHECKING
+
+if TYPE_CHECKING:
+ from django.db.models import Manager
+ from user.models import User
+
+
+class Team(models.Model):
+ user_set: Manager[User]
+
+
+class Role(models.Model):
+ users: Manager[User]
+
+reveal_type(Team().user_set)
+# note: Revealed type is 'Manager[User]'
+reveal_type(Role().users)
+# note: Revealed type is 'Manager[User]'
+```
+
+
+### `id Field`
+
+By default Django will create an `AutoField` for you if one doesn't exist.
+
+For type checkers to know about the `id` field you'll need to declare the
+field explicitly.
+
+```python
+# before
+class Post(models.Model):
+ ...
+
+# after
+class Post(models.Model):
+ id = models.AutoField(primary_key=True)
+ # OR
+ id: int
+```
+
+### `HttpRequest`'s `user` property
+
+The `HttpRequest`'s `user` property has a type of `Union[AbstractBaseUser, AnonymousUser]`,
+but for most of your views you'll probably want either an authed user or an
+`AnonymousUser`.
+
+So we can define a subclass for each case:
+
+```python
+class AuthedHttpRequest(HttpRequest):
+ user: User # type: ignore [assignment]
+```
+
+And then you can use it in your views:
+
+```python
+@auth.login_required
+def activity(request: AuthedHttpRequest, team_id: str) -> HttpResponse:
+ ...
+```
+
+You can also get more strict with your `login_required` decorator so that the
+first argument of the function it is decorating is `AuthedHttpRequest`:
+
+```python
+from typing import Any, Union, TypeVar, cast
+from django.http import HttpRequest, HttpResponse
+from typing_extensions import Protocol
+from functools import wraps
+
+class RequestHandler1(Protocol):
+ def __call__(self, request: AuthedHttpRequest) -> HttpResponse:
+ ...
+
+
+class RequestHandler2(Protocol):
+ def __call__(self, request: AuthedHttpRequest, __arg1: Any) -> HttpResponse:
+ ...
+
+
+RequestHandler = Union[RequestHandler1, RequestHandler2]
+
+
+# Verbose bound arg due to limitations of Python typing.
+# see: https://github.com/python/mypy/issues/5876
+_F = TypeVar("_F", bound=RequestHandler)
+
+
+def login_required(view_func: _F) -> _F:
+ @wraps(view_func)
+ def wrapped_view(
+ request: AuthedHttpRequest, *args: object, **kwargs: object
+ ) -> HttpResponse:
+ if request.user.is_authenticated:
+ return view_func(request, *args, **kwargs) # type: ignore [call-arg]
+ raise AuthenticationRequired
+
+ return cast(_F, wrapped_view)
+```
+
+Then the following will type error:
+
+```python
+@auth.login_required
+def activity(request: HttpRequest, team_id: str) -> HttpResponse:
+ ...
+```
+
